Australia: “It Was Fraud To Include Aborigines In The 1967 Census” An Aboriginal leader has thrown open the possibility of Commonwealth government having “committed a major fraud against the Australian public” in connection with the 1967 referendum that included Aborigines in the national census for the first time.
